What Is Chicken Stock Powder?

Chicken stock powder is a dehydrated, concentrated seasoning made from chicken extract, salt, flavor enhancers, and other additives. It is designed to mimic the taste of homemade chicken stock but in a dry, shelf-stable form. The powder is typically used as a flavor enhancer in cooking, allowing for quick infusion of savory chicken flavor into dishes without the time-consuming process of boiling bones and meat.

Ingredients Commonly Found in Chicken Stock Powder

  • Salt: The primary seasoning component, providing flavor and acting as a preservative.
  • Dehydrated Chicken Extract or Powder: The core flavoring ingredient derived from cooked chicken or chicken broth.
  • Flavor Enhancers (e.g., Monosodium Glutamate - MSG): Enhance the umami taste, making dishes more savory.
  • Dehydrated Vegetables and Herbs: Sometimes included for added flavor complexity.
  • Preservatives and Anti-caking Agents: Prevent clumping and extend shelf life.

It's important to note that ingredient lists vary among brands, with some products containing artificial flavors, preservatives, or MSG, while others aim for cleaner, more natural formulations.

Health Considerations of Chicken Stock Powder

While chicken stock powder offers convenience, it's essential to consider its nutritional profile and potential health impacts.

Advantages of Using Chicken Stock Powder

  • Convenience: Significantly reduces preparation time for flavorful dishes.
  • Long Shelf Life: Can be stored for months or years without spoilage.
  • Portion Control: Easy to measure and adjust seasoning levels.
  • Cost-Effective: Often cheaper than purchasing pre-made broth or making homemade stock.

Potential Drawbacks and Health Risks

  • High Sodium Content: Many stock powders contain large amounts of salt, which can contribute to high blood pressure and other cardiovascular issues if consumed excessively.
  • Artificial Additives: Some brands include flavor enhancers like MSG, preservatives, and artificial flavors, which may cause sensitivities or adverse reactions in some individuals.
  • Lack of Nutrients: Unlike homemade stock, which contains nutrients leached from bones and vegetables, stock powder offers minimal nutritional benefits.
  • Possible Allergens: Ingredients like wheat (gluten), soy, or other additives may pose risks for allergy sufferers.

Is Chicken Stock Powder Healthy?

The healthiness of chicken stock powder largely depends on the product's ingredients and your overall diet. If you choose a product with natural ingredients, low sodium, and no artificial additives, it can be a convenient way to enhance flavor without compromising health. However, frequent consumption of highly processed stock powders with high salt and additive content may contribute to health issues over time.

For a healthier option, consider using homemade stock or low-sodium commercial varieties, and use chicken stock powder sparingly as a flavor enhancer rather than a primary ingredient.

How to Choose Quality Chicken Stock Powder

  • Check the Ingredient List: Opt for products with natural ingredients, minimal preservatives, and low sodium content.
  • Look for Natural Flavors: Avoid products with artificial flavors or MSG if you are sensitive or prefer cleaner ingredients.
  • Consider Organic or Non-GMO Options: These may be better choices for health-conscious consumers.
  • Read Customer Reviews: Feedback can provide insight into the flavor quality and ingredient transparency of a product.
  • Compare Brands: Evaluate based on price, ingredients, and reviews to find the best balance of quality and affordability.

Uses and Tips for Cooking with Chicken Stock Powder

Chicken stock powder is incredibly versatile and can be used in numerous dishes:

  • Soups and Stews: Add directly to broth for depth of flavor.
  • Sauces and Gravies: Enhance the savory profile of homemade sauces.
  • Marinades: Mix with herbs and spices for flavorful chicken or meat marinades.
  • Rice and Grains: Cook grains in water with stock powder for extra flavor.
  • Vegetable Dishes: Season roasted or sautéed vegetables.

When using chicken stock powder, start with small amounts and taste as you go to avoid over-salting your dishes. Remember to adjust salt levels accordingly if your stock powder is high in sodium.

Alternatives to Chicken Stock Powder

If you're concerned about additives or sodium, here are healthier or more natural alternatives:

  • Homemade Chicken Stock: Simmer chicken bones, vegetables, herbs, and spices for homemade broth rich in nutrients.
  • Low-Sodium Broth: Use store-bought or homemade low-sodium broth as a liquid base.
  • Vegetable Stock: For a vegetarian alternative, make or buy vegetable stock with natural ingredients.
  • Flavor Enhancers like Nutritional Yeast: Add umami flavor without excessive salt or artificial additives.
